Puteaux, a charming commune on the western outskirts of Paris, France, offers a delightful escape from the hustle and bustle of the capital while still providing easy access to its many attractions. Nestled on the banks of the Seine River, Puteaux is part of the La Défense business district, known for its modern skyscrapers and the iconic Grande Arche, a contemporary take on the Arc de Triomphe.
Visitors to Puteaux can enjoy a blend of cultural and recreational activities. The town's historical center, with its traditional French architecture, quaint streets, and local shops, invites leisurely exploration. The Église Notre-Dame-de-Pitié, a beautiful church, stands as a testament to the area's rich history.
For those interested in the arts, the Theatre de Puteaux offers a variety of performances, from plays to concerts and dance shows. The town also hosts several festivals and events throughout the year, providing a glimpse into local traditions and celebrations.
Nature enthusiasts will appreciate Puteaux's green spaces, such as the Parc Lebaudy - Île de Puteaux, an island park accessible via a footbridge. It's a perfect spot for picnics, sports, and family outings, with facilities including tennis courts, a swimming pool, and a petanque area. The nearby Bois de Boulogne, a large public park, offers additional opportunities for walking, boating, and relaxation.
Gastronomy plays a significant role in Puteaux's appeal, with a variety of restaurants serving both traditional French cuisine and international dishes. The local market is a hub of activity where fresh produce, cheeses, meats, and baked goods can be savored and purchased.
For those looking to indulge in some shopping, the Les Quatre Temps shopping center in La Défense is one of the largest in Europe, featuring a wide array of stores, eateries, and entertainment options.
Puteaux's proximity to Paris means that visitors can easily venture into the city to experience its world-famous landmarks, museums, and cultural life. After a day of sightseeing, Puteaux offers a peaceful retreat to unwind and reflect on the day's adventures.
